Superfamily: Type VI secretion system, lipoprotein SciN

Structural domains comprising this superfamily share the structure of the type VI secrection system (T6SS) lipoprotein SciN, essential for T6S-dependent secretion of the Hcp-like SciD protein and for biofilm formation. SciN is tethered to the outer membrane and exposed in the periplasm.

Alternative names for this lipoproteins include SciN and Lip.
